What is Ashton Kutcher’s net worth in 2024?
Ashton Kutcher has an estimated net worth of $200 million in 2024.
His wealth primarily comes from his successful career as an actor, producer, and entrepreneur.
Initially, Ashton Kutcher rose to prominence by portraying the character Michael Kelso on the widely-acclaimed TV sitcom ‘That ’70s Show’. Later, he established himself as a significant figure in the film industry, appearing in successful films such as ‘Dude, Where’s My Car?’, ‘The Butterfly Effect’, and ‘Jobs’.

Ashton Kutcher’s earnings explained — how does he make money?
Ashton Kutcher earns money from his diverse professional ventures.
Kutcher’s Early Success in Acting: Initially, Kutcher became widely recognized and financially successful through his acting endeavors. He garnered significant wealth from his performances in television series and films, particularly from That ’70s Show and Two and a Half Men. In the latter, he pocketed $800,000 per episode, which equated to approximately $20 million per season, positioning him among the highest-earning TV actors during that period.
Aside from Acting, Kutcher’s Venture Capital Endeavors: Beyond his acting career, Kutcher has also made a name for himself as a successful venture capitalist. Through his firm, A-Grade Investments, he has made early investments in companies such as Uber, Airbnb, Spotify, and more. His ventures have proven to be highly profitable, transforming an initial $30 million into $250 million worth of assets. This venture capital work now constitutes a significant portion of his income and wealth.
Besides acting, Kutcher has supplemented his income by producing television shows. Notably, he is recognized for creating and hosting Punk’d, a hidden camera show that gained popularity. He has also produced other TV series like Beauty and the Geek and The Ranch, thereby adding to his wealth.
Real Estate Ventures: Aside from acting, Kutcher has amassed wealth through property investments. He’s transacted numerous luxury properties, including his Hollywood Hills house which he bought for $8.455 million and resold at $9.925 million. These real estate transactions have contributed to his overall financial growth.
